10 Percent Down Mortgage



A down payment is the amount of cash you put toward the purchase of a home. It may be expressed as a percentage. For instance, it usually takes a 20 percent down payment to buy a home without private mortgage insurance. It may also be expressed as a dollar amount. As in, you have $15,000 available for a down payment.

 · Generally, the first mortgage is set at 80% of the home’s value and the second loan is for 10%. The remaining 10% comes from the home-buyer’s savings as a down payment. This is also called an 80-10-10 loan. A 10 percent gifted down payment exceeds the FHA’s minimum requirement, but does not replace the need for mortgage insurance.

You Can Get a Conventional Mortgage with 10% Down. A 20% down payment is recommended, but it’s not required for getting a mortgage. Lenders can underwrite conventional, 30-year, fixed-rate loans for buyers who bring 10% to the table, too.

 · 4. A Lower Interest Rate = You Pay Less Over The Life Of The Loan. The interest charged on a loan with 20 percent down is often lower than the interest on a loan with less money down.

If you put 10 percent down on a $300,000 home with a 30-year fixed mortgage at 4.33 percent interest, you’ll owe nearly $213,000 in interest over the course of the loan.
